Fform Iaith Genedlaethol

Sub fonds contain papers related to the work of Fforwm Iaith Genedlaethol (National Language Forum), an umbrella group of 26 organisations which was formed to campaign for a Welsh Language Act and which developed Strategaeth Iaith 1991-2001, a strategy to secure a safe and prosperous future for the Welsh language.
Member organisations of Fforwm Iaith Genedlaethol includes; Adfer, Canolfan Iaith Clwyd, Canolfan Iaith Genedalethol Nant Gwrtheyrn, Cefn, Cyd, Cymdeithas y Cyfamodwyr, Cymdeithas Tau Gwledig Cymru, Cymdeithas yr Iaith, Cyngor Llyfrau Cymraeg, Merched y Wawr, Mudiad Ysgol Meithryn, Pont, Pwyllgor Gyd-enwadol yr Iaith Gymraeg Arfon, Rhieni dros Addysg Gymraeg, Undeb Cenedlaethol Athrawon Cymru, Undeb Cenedlaethol Myfyrwyr Cymru, Undeb Myfyrwyr Cymraeg Aberystwyth, Undeb Myfyrwyr Cymraeg Bangor, Urdd Gobaith Cymru, Y Colegiwm Cymraeg, Y Gymdeithas Feddygol, and Eisteddfod Genedlaethol Cymru.

Fforwm Iaith Genedlaethol

Administrative Papers

Series contains the administrative papers of Y Cabinet Iaith (The Language Cabinet) and Fforwm Iaith Genedlaethol (National Language Forum), dealing mainly with the running of the Forum and correspondence related to campaigns and projects.

Cabinet Iaith meeting papers

Papers relating to the work of Y Cabinet Iaith (Language cabinet) in 1988 and 1989 including press releases, drafts of letters, lists of people attending meetings, details of a Welsh Language Bill proposed by Lord Gwilym Prys-Davies and Dafydd Wigley.

Welsh Language Schemes

File contains Welsh Language strategies and Welsh Language Schemes prepared as a result of the Welsh Language Act 1993 from a number of bodies; Cymdeithas Tai Eryri, Dyfed County Council, Isle of Anglesey County Council, the Society for Welsh in Education, the Welsh Office and Gwynedd Council.
